Beach Energy finds gas in Otway Basin
The well in licence VIC/P43 intersected a gross gas column of 69.5 m in the Upper Waarre Formation, including 62.9 m of net gas pay, with a gaswater contact intersected at 1990 m measured depth.
Up to 120 million bbl discovered near Fram field in North Sea
Preliminary estimates place the size of the discovery between 12 and 19 million m3 of recoverable oil equivalent, corresponding to 75-120 million bbl of recoverable oil equivalent.

Sercel equipment deployed in North African seismic survey
The crew is operating with an 80 000-channel 508XT land acquisition system, complete with QuietSeis® digital sensors, and 10 Nomad 90 Neo broadband vibrators in challenging desert terrain.
Fugro carrying out seep survey and geochemical campaign for Petronas Suriname E&P B.V.
The campaign involves geophysical data collection, heat flow measurements, core sampling and onboard geochemical analyses, which aim to optimise future exploration activities offshore Suriname.
Oil discovery made near Johan Castberg field
Recoverable resources at exploration well 7220/7-4 in production licence 532 are so far estimated at between 5 and 8 million m3 of recoverable oil, corresponding to 31 – 50 million bbl of recoverable oil.
CGG launches phase two of multi-client 3D survey in the Northern North Sea
The second phase will expand on the phase one acquisition initiated in 2020 to add a second azimuth over CGG’s existing Northern Viking Graben 3D survey offshore Norway.
